Andrew Nembhard Out At Least One Week With Knee Harm


Indiana Pacers guard will miss no less than one week on account of a proper knee damage. Nembhard appeared to hyperextend his knee within the Pacers In-Season Event semifinal sport in opposition to the Milwaukee Bucks on Thursday.

The Pacers say the second-year participant appears to have his knee ligaments all totally intact. Indiana head coach Rick Carlisle known as Nembhard “week to week”, and mentioned he’d be re-evaluated in a single week.
